Product Overview

dDSpeedScan
dDSpeedScan

Description: dDSpeedScan is a free disk benchmarking software for Windows. It allows users to measure read, write, and seek speeds for any drive. dDSpeedScan provides detailed graphs and statistics to analyze drive performance.

Type: software

Pricing: Open Source

Document Writer
Document Writer

Description: Document Writer is a word processing software that allows users to create, edit, format, and print documents. It has basic features like typing text, adding images, changing fonts, inserting tables, etc. Document Writer is easy to use and suitable for basic home and office uses.

Type: software

Pricing: Freemium

Key Features Comparison

dDSpeedScan
dDSpeedScan Features
  • Measures read, write and seek speeds for hard drives
  • Supports SSD, HDD, external drives and more
  • Detailed graphs and statistics for performance analysis
  • Ability to test specific file sizes or full drive
  • Portable version available
  • Free and open source
Document Writer
Document Writer Features
  • Word processing
  • Editing text
  • Formatting text
  • Inserting images
  • Page layout options
  • Spell check
  • Basic document templates

Pros & Cons Analysis

dDSpeedScan
dDSpeedScan
Pros
  • Simple and easy to use interface
  • Lightweight and fast testing
  • Completely free with no ads or limitations
  • Works for any drive connected to your PC
  • Provides in-depth metrics for performance
  • Actively developed and maintained
Cons
  • Lacks some advanced benchmarking features
  • UI is dated and basic
  • Limited customization options
  • No mobile version available
  • Requires admin access on Windows
Document Writer
Document Writer
Pros
  • User-friendly interface
  • Affordable
  • Good for basic documents
  • Compatible across devices
  • Auto-save feature
Cons
  • Limited advanced features
  • Fewer formatting options than advanced software
  • Not suitable for complex documents
  • Lacks collaboration features
